How to Install and Uninstall python3-atomicwrites.noarch Package on Fedora 34

Last updated: October 05,2024

1. Install "python3-atomicwrites.noarch" package

Please follow the steps below to install python3-atomicwrites.noarch on Fedora 34

$ sudo dnf update $ sudo dnf install python3-atomicwrites.noarch

2. Uninstall "python3-atomicwrites.noarch" package

This tutorial shows how to uninstall python3-atomicwrites.noarch on Fedora 34:

$ sudo dnf remove python3-atomicwrites.noarch $ sudo dnf autoremove

3. Information about the python3-atomicwrites.noarch package on Fedora 34

Available Packages
Name : python3-atomicwrites
Version : 1.4.0
Release : 6.fc34
Architecture : noarch
Size : 23 k
Source : python-atomicwrites-1.4.0-6.fc34.src.rpm
Repository : fedora
Summary : Python Atomic file writes on POSIX
URL : https://github.com/untitaker/python-atomicwrites
License : MIT
Description : This Python module provides atomic file writes on POSIX operating systems.
: It sports:
: * Race-free assertion that the target file doesn't yet exist
: * Windows support
: * Simple high-level API that wraps a very flexible class-based API
